Transaction a21dc7b1ae17e49282a695a212359d4614bc81f70167f34f1b4724eb5a66cd84

1 Input
2 Outputs
  • a21dc7b1ae17e49282a695a212359d4614bc81f70167f34f1b4724eb5a66cd84:0
  • value  2059080239
    address  3AzG4dAzd4KzRtb6AcbzEG5djU4YcmoGUc
  • a21dc7b1ae17e49282a695a212359d4614bc81f70167f34f1b4724eb5a66cd84:1
  • value  580000
    address  3GfWQBjWbRT2ZirczESoBk5gH8dJM5ecM6